Radiofrequency ablation for selective reduction in complicated monochorionic multiple pregnancies.

Jing Lu1, Yuen Ha Ting, Kwok Ming Law

  • 1Department of Ultrasound Medicine, Prenatal Diagnosis Center of Xiamen, Maternal and Child Health Hospital, Xiamen, SAR, China.

Fetal Diagnosis and Therapy
|October 26, 2013
PubMed
Summary

Radiofrequency ablation (RFA) offers a promising approach for selective reduction in complicated monochorionic (MC) pregnancies. This technique demonstrated a high co-twin survival rate and a low complication rate in a recent case series.

Area of Science:

  • Perinatology
  • Maternal-Fetal Medicine
  • Interventional Obstetrics

Background:

  • Monochorionic (MC) multiple pregnancies present unique challenges due to placental sharing.
  • Selective reduction is a therapeutic option for MC pregnancies with specific complications.

Purpose of the Study:

  • To assess the perinatal outcomes of monochorionic multiple pregnancies following selective reduction using radiofrequency ablation (RFA).

Main Methods:

  • A case series review of MC pregnancies undergoing selective reduction via RFA at a single institution.
  • Data collected included indications for reduction, gestational age at procedure and delivery, and survival rates.

Main Results:

  • Ten MC pregnancies (9 twins, 1 triplet) underwent RFA at a median of 15.6 weeks gestation.
  • Indications included fetal anomalies, TRAP sequence, IUGR, and TTTS.
  • The co-twin survival rate was 81.8% (9/11), with a median delivery at 35.9 weeks and a low rate of preterm delivery before 34 weeks.

Conclusions:

  • Radiofrequency ablation (RFA) is a viable and effective technique for selective reduction in complicated MC pregnancies.
  • The procedure is associated with a high survival rate for the co-twin and a low incidence of major complications.
